ARKANSAS BLUE CROSS AND BLUE SHIELDSMALL GROUP BLUESENROLL GROUP ADMINISTRATOR’S MANUALSection 4 - MANAGED DRUG PROGRAMOVERVIEWIn an effort to help hold the line on escalating prescription medication costs,<strong>Arkansas</strong> <strong>Blue</strong> <strong>Cross</strong> <strong>and</strong> <strong>Blue</strong> <strong>Shield</strong> provides a Managed Pharmacy Programthat will help maintain quality health care.The information in this section will give you an overview of the ManagedPharmacy Program <strong>and</strong> help you find answers to questions about howemployees can best utilize their benefits. Specific details about the employee’spharmacy benefits should be discussed with a Customer Service Representativeof Caremark.The Managed Pharmacy Program is designed to eliminate the need for claimforms when using a participating pharmacy. If an employee uses a nonparticipatingout-of-state pharmacy, a claim form will be necessary forreimbursement of these charges. Pharmacy claim forms are provided uponrequest.The <strong>Arkansas</strong> <strong>Blue</strong> <strong>Cross</strong>/Health Advantage Managed Pharmacy Program,administered through Caremark, contracts with more than 57,000 pharmaciesnationwide to help ensure employee have access to the medications they needwherever they go.Once a prescription is filled, the pharmacist will store the personal prescriptionhistory in a state-of-the art system to alert the pharmacist to dangerous druginteractions, allergies, sensitivities to medications, <strong>and</strong> chronic ailments. Thesequality assurance measures help to protect the employee <strong>and</strong> enhance thequality of care.BENEFITSThe Managed Pharmacy Program offers customers <strong>and</strong> their covereddependents benefits, including the following:• Cost savings• No claim forms• Nominal co-payments <strong>and</strong>/or coinsurance• Specialized customer service• Access to an extensive pharmacy networkWhen an employee presents an ID card, participating pharmacists (working withthe employee’s physician) can closely monitor medication therapy.
